Court rejects Elon Musk’s attempt to prevent OpenAI’s shift to a for-profit model

A federal judge in California, citing insufficient evidence for legal action, rejected an attempt by tech billionaire Elon Musk to prevent OpenAI’s shift to a for-profit model.

Highlighting the potential harm and public interest, Judge Yvonne Gonzalez Rogers offered to expedite the trial in order to allay worries regarding OpenAI’s transition.

Musk said that OpenAI’s conversion may cause market instability and deter investment in competitors, which is why he filed the injunction to keep the company nonprofit.
